Entertainment and navigation at sea have never been so much fun. Connect your iPhone, iPad or iPod Touch to your ship's network and navigation system and give you all the important information quickly and easily in your hand.
Whether it is navigation data, wind speed or water depth, your new crew member "NMEAremote" shows at a glance everything that you need to know.
NMEAremote, a cutting-edge, intuitive user-friendly app, displays any real-time marine data from the boat's central data system (NMEA, SignalK, Expedition, H5000,...) to an Apple mobile display such as iPhone, iPad, iPod Touch, Watch or ActiveLook® smartglass. Be mobile and connect your device to all your NMEA devices over WLAN, Bluetooth or a computer with the appropriate software.
Made with passion for sailors by a sailor as the first NMEA app in the AppStore, NMEAremote has grown up to a swiss army knife for marine, navigation and performance data and its versatile options won’t lack any display needs.
Whether you use NMEAremote for racing or cruising, sailing or motoring, this all-in-one app will help you enjoy your time on the water and improve your safety and performance.
Key-Features:
∙ Supports NMEA 0183, NMEA 2000, SignalK or MQTT data of almost any device
∙ Compatible with Expedition & B&G H5000
∙ Simple setup with preconfigured sources plus versatile configuration options
∙ Bold & easy to read multifunctional displays
∙ Intuitive and easy paging
∙ Fully customizable dashboard
∙ Favorite pages & Auto Scroll
∙ Multiple dashboard styles
∙ All values grouped into clear 'Modules'
∙ Individual smoothing of all numeric values
∙ Independent configurable units
∙ Alarms
∙ Apple Watch App
∙ ActiveLook® smartglass integration
∙ Unlimited NMEA Log
∙ Server/Repeater to forward NMEA messages to other devices (some NMEA-WiFi gateways are accepting only one client)
∙ Background updates
∙ Environments to handle different setups
∙ Message-Rules: Block, Gate Time and TalkerID for each NMEA sentence

NOT Supported Devices:
∙ Garmin GNT 10 & chartplotters
∙ Raymarine WiFi devices
(these manufacturers are not interested in collaborating and still keeping their systems secret)
Available Modules & Data (either from NMEA network, derived or calculated)
∙ AIS: CPA, TCPA
∙ Battery*: VOLT, AMP, TEMP,...
∙ Engine*: RPM,...
∙ Environment: Sea, Air, Set, Drift,...
∙ GPS: LAT, LON, COG, SOG,...
∙ Heading: HDG, HEEL, ROT,...
∙ Navigation: WP, DTW, BTW, XTE,...
∙ Navtex
∙ Performance: Polar SPD, Target TWA, Beat, Run, Next Leg,...
∙ Racing: PIN, RC, BIAS, DTS, BTS, TTS,...
∙ Rig: Stays, Shrouds, Halyards,...
∙ Rudder*: Angle
∙ Sounder: DPT
∙ Switch*: Status
∙ Tank*: LVL, CAP, ...
∙ Time: UTC, Local, Timezone
∙ Timer: Countdown,...
∙ Transducer
∙ Velocity: SPD, Log, Trip
∙ Vessel
∙ Wind: AWA, AWS, TWA, TWS, TWD, BFT
* supports multiple instances

Must have NMEA appI am using the NMEAremote app with my Quark Elec A026+ AIS Multiplexer and gives me all the NMEA0183 and NMEA2000 data I need on my WiFi only iPad. I get AIS data, GPS position, SOG, COG, Depth, Sea Water Temperature,etc. I will soon add Wind data from the NMEA2000 wind sensor and battery, charging and tank level level data from Victron Energy Cerbo GX. A great app with tons of customisations. You can easily add pages and choose the layout and then add the data elements you need. Works also great in a split window with Navionics boating app. Highly recommend!!!.Version: 3.0.11

Leaves a bit to be desiredI love the idea of this app and it works pretty well! However, I did not find the UI intuitive (I’ve been an app developer for over 10 years). My biggest wish is AWA and TWA relative to my course - like my Raymarine instruments display. Perhaps this exists but I was unable to find it after 20 minutes of set up. The double tap to edit/add a gauge is difficult to discover. The green + and the multi blue plus are not obvious as to what they do. Overall, I’d suggest that the developer hand the app to a brand new user and watch them try to use it, noting the UX pain points and feature discoverability. A nice technical app and good integrations, but could use some polish to be great. I’m unaware of a better option on the App Store..Version: 3.0.15
Extremely useful appRecently made extensive use of the app, both on iPhone and iPad on a two week trip around Bonin Islands. Used a Latronix WiBox transmitting NMEA data via UDP. Worked flawlessly. The main use was to have the ability to be in one's bunk and see what was going on topside when off watch, or just coming on watch. The alarms were also helpful in making sure we didn't get lazy with what sails to have up based wind speeds and angle. The author is one of the best developers I have come across in terms of willingness to work with users and incorporate feedback or make slight adjustments. Look for updates, as the developer is constantly improving the app. Get it if you are on a boat with wifi and NMEA data, you won't be disappointed..Version: 1.3
